XML 65 R43.htm IDEA: XBRL DOCUMENT v3.10.0.1
Derivative Instruments - Schedule of Derivative Assets and Liabilities (Details) - USD ($)
$ in Millions
Jun. 30, 2018
Dec. 31, 2017
Derivative [Line Items]    
Total net derivative asset (liability) $ 24 $ (29)
Derivative instruments designated as hedges    
Derivative [Line Items]    
Total net derivative asset (liability) 14 (19)
Derivative instruments not designated as hedges    
Derivative [Line Items]    
Total net derivative asset (liability) 10 (10)
Prepaid expenses and other current assets | Foreign exchange contracts | Derivative instruments designated as hedges    
Derivative [Line Items]    
Derivative asset, fair value 16 0
Prepaid expenses and other current assets | Foreign exchange contracts | Derivative instruments not designated as hedges    
Derivative [Line Items]    
Derivative asset, fair value 1 0
Accrued liabilities | Foreign exchange contracts | Derivative instruments designated as hedges    
Derivative [Line Items]    
Derivative liability, fair value 0 (9)
Accrued liabilities | Foreign exchange contracts | Derivative instruments not designated as hedges    
Derivative [Line Items]    
Derivative liability, fair value 0 (2)
Accrued liabilities | Forward interest rate swaps | Derivative instruments designated as hedges    
Derivative [Line Items]    
Derivative liability, fair value (1) (2)
Accrued liabilities | Forward interest rate swaps | Derivative instruments not designated as hedges    
Derivative [Line Items]    
Derivative liability, fair value (3) (1)
Other long-term assets | Forward interest rate swaps | Derivative instruments not designated as hedges    
Derivative [Line Items]    
Derivative asset, fair value 12 0
Other long-term liabilities | Forward interest rate swaps | Derivative instruments designated as hedges    
Derivative [Line Items]    
Derivative liability, fair value (1) (8)
Other long-term liabilities | Forward interest rate swaps | Derivative instruments not designated as hedges    
Derivative [Line Items]    
Derivative liability, fair value $ 0 $ (7)